Description We're looking for an enthusiastic Assistant Buyer to join our buying team. This role is ideal for someone with some buying experience who is ready to take the next step in their career while working with industry-leading brands. Key job responsibilities
Partner with Buyers on category management and strategic initiatives
Execute buying plans and maintain product assortments
Monitor inventory levels and recommend reorder quantities
Track and analyze sales performance metrics
Maintain vendor relationships and assist in negotiations
Create and maintain purchase orders
Support markdown optimization and promotional strategies
Assist in seasonal line reviews and buying meetings
Ensure accurate product setup and data integrity
Collaborate with Planning, Marketing, and Operations teams A day in the life You will make a positive impact on customer experience through continuous monitoring of Zappos.
com and competitor sites through the lens of the customer. The ideal candidate will be experienced in using the tools and reports to develop a deeper understanding of customer behavior. Being an excellent communicator is a must as you will need to cultivate mutually beneficial relationships with vendors based on openness and trust.
